Umm. That bugzilla entry seems to be talking about a *sane* change, namely

-  ({ unsigned long int __d = (d);                                          \
+  ({ unsigned long int __d = (unsigned long int) (d);                      \

in __FD_ELT(), which is totally different from the one Josh talks about.
Right. Josh's change is necessary to prevent warnings from folks (incorrectly) using posix_types.h instead of select.h after the change in that BZ was made. That's why I originally stated that, arguably, posix_types.h really should go away or just use the definitions provided by glibc.
